Used a 30x scope on the GDP and C99. Even though the top of the GDP cola looks so frosty it looks covered in spider egg sacks...I see mostly clear (~60%) trichomes. I plan to do a slow harvest, branch by branch, bud by bud as each achieves maximum cloudiness.

I love my deep pot drench method of watering. Typically, I go one week between waterings now. Every second watering gets Gnatrol (r).

Remarkably, very little odor at week 7 since 12s. I unzip the tent and I get scent of subtle fruit and flower, and an ever so slight diesel. I guess my filter is getting the job done.

OK, couldn't resist. The pistils were brown and the trichomes at least 80% cloudy.

I was able to harvest and jar so quickly because of a Spinpro Trimmer, and a food dehydrator. The trimmer made trimming an ephemeral joy. The dehydrator will dry my bud in three stages.

I. Initial dry dor a couple of hours. Jar. Redry in a couple of hours, re-jar.
II. The next day repeat at one hour, rolling jars so the bud mofes gently around. Burp often.
III. The next day dehydrate to taste. Re-jar. Test vape bud. Report on 420 Magazine (r).
